Versatility and value best describe the YT-250 tuner. This model can tune any instrument across eight octaves quickly and accurately using its high-resolution LCD meter display. Made possible by sharp/flat/in-tune LEDs, tuning in the dark or from a distance becomes a breeze.

Features

  • Precise tuning for any instrument across 8 octaves
  • Built-in microphone allowing you to tune acoustical instruments
  • Auto Mode offering fast tuning by automatically selecting the closest tone programmed in the tuner
  • Large liquid crystal display with high-resolution that is easy to read
  • Tilt slot allowing you to insert a coin into the slot and tilt the tuner back for easy viewing
  • In/Out jacks permitting you to insert the tuner between your instrument and the amp without dealing with connections every time
  • Battery powered to be used anywhere

Yamaha YT-250 Guitar Tuner

John Richards
December 31, 2007

Rating: 8/10

After half an hour of taking this unit out of the box, I scurried to find the discarded packaging. Nothing wrong, you understand; I just had to check the price I\'d paid for this wonderful little unit. The build quality and presentation suggest a unit costing at least twice as much.

The quality packaging contains everything you need to get going straight away - even a decent battery, which slips easily into the rear compartment via a clip-on cover - so no need to go hunting for a screwdriver, bowie knife or whatever else you wouldn\'t want to find yourself fumbling around for in the dark.

The unit is compact (118 x 63 x 24.5 mm) and made of a rugged feeling black plastic. So it would be safe at home in either your pocket or guitar bag without taking up the space you need for spare strings, plucks etc. For such a small box, it feels reasuringly heavy (130g)in the hand - further testiment to its likely long-term durability.

The layout is simple but thoroughly functional. The power switch is safely recessed on the right hand side of the device, adjacent to 1/4\" jack input and outputs.

The front is neatly arranged with a backlit lcd screen in the centre with crisp, clear graphics. My only critism is that this display is really very small - though thats the price you have to pay for such a compact unit. All is not lost; in compensation beneath the display are three bright LED\'s which aid visibility whilst tuning if you have the unit some distance away from you.Two are yellow, respectively indicating flat (undertuned) and sharp (overtuning) conditions, with a central green LED confirming when you\'ve got it spot on. Beneath these are three control buttons marked MODE, PITCH and NOTE.

A nice touch, is that the condenser microphone is situated on the front panel. This makes it a lot easier when tuning acoustic guitars as the unit can be placed directly in front, within line of sight, thus ensuring optimum usability for the guitarist and ensuring a decent signal is picked up from the guitar, thereby elliminating the spurious noises that are often detected when the microphones are situated on the side of such devices.

The device is really easy to use and operation is almost self explanatory. However, for the novice detailed and nicely illustrated instructions are included. The unit offers both manula and auto modes of input.

In AUTO mode, switching on defaults to a standard pitch of A4 = 440HZ. This may easily be varried in 12 stages from 435 to 446 Hz by toggling the PITCH switch. In Auto mode, the unit automatically detects the string being played, so all you have to do is play one string at a time and keep an eye on the LEDs/LCD display as you make adjustments. For use with electric guitars, the unit can be left in-line whilst playing. However, Yamaha recommend that the device be turned off in order to minimise noise. In reality, this is only likely to be a problem at high volumes through powerfull PAs, or when direct injecting to a mixer in the studio.

In MANUAL mode, the device is again easy to use, and requires only that you first select the appropriate note by toggling the note button. Job done - pop it in your pocket, safely away from the lumbering feet of your front-man.

In conclusion, this is a neat little unit for use by the novice or semi-pro. It\'s compact, durable and nicely priced. It was consistently easy to use, giving accurate results. The device covers eight octaves and, useful for beginners, notes are displayed in the order as your gear. The only foible was the slightly small LCD display but, in practice this will not be an issue. Snap one up whilst you can.
